The vendor, Bankers Life, contracts with Humana to offer health insurance policies in select states. On Oct. 25, the company told Humana it discovered an unauthorized user had gained access to some employees’ system credentials and may have viewed Humana members’ protected health information between May 30 and Sept., 13, 2018.
An investigation t determined Humana applicants’ names, addresses, dates of birth, last four digits of Social Security numbers and limited health insurance policy information had been compromised.
Bankers Life is offering potentially affected individuals one year of identity repair and credit monitoring services as a precaution.
